What Do Faculties Specializing In Brain And Neural Sciences Think About, And How Do They Approach, Brain-Friendly Teaching-Learning In Iran?, Sahar Ghanbari, Fariba Haghani, Malahat Akbarfahimi Oct 2019

What Do Faculties Specializing In Brain And Neural Sciences Think About, And How Do They Approach, Brain-Friendly Teaching-Learning In Iran?, Sahar Ghanbari, Fariba Haghani, Malahat Akbarfahimi

Journal of Mind and Medical Sciences

Objective: to investigate the perspectives and experiences of the faculties specializing in brain and neural sciences regarding brain-friendly teaching-learning in Iran. Methods: 17 faculties from 5 universities were selected by purposive sampling (2018). In-depth semi-structured interviews with directed content analysis were used. Results: 31 sub-subcategories, 10 subcategories, and 4 categories were formed according to the “General teaching model”. “Mentorship” was a newly added category. Conclusions: A neuro-educational approach that consider the roles of the learner’s brain uniqueness, executive function facilitation, and the valence system are important to learning. Commentary: The Use Of Case-Based Learning And Concept Mapping To Teach Students Clinical Reasoning, Jeremy R. Hawkins, Michael Reeder, Michael Olson, Amy Bronson Mar 2019

Commentary: The Use Of Case-Based Learning And Concept Mapping To Teach Students Clinical Reasoning, Jeremy R. Hawkins, Michael Reeder, Michael Olson, Amy Bronson

Journal of Sports Medicine and Allied Health Sciences: Official Journal of the Ohio Athletic Trainers Association

Introduction: Teaching students as inexperienced clinicians the process of evaluating athletic injuries and medical conditions is often challenging. Utilizing case-based learning and concept mapping as educational tools can facilitate growth in the clinical and diagnostic decision making process. Discussion: Experienced clinicians regularly employ case pattern recognition and hypothetico-deductive reasoning in clinical settings. Each type of reasoning is prone to anchoring and confirmation bias, devaluing relevant information, and framing effect if not utilized correctly.
